Police: Man robs Monroe bank

MONROE, Wash. — The robbery happened at the Union Bank in the 200 block of West Main Street after 5:30 p.m.

According to police, the man came into the bank and passed a note to the teller demanding money. A weapon was implied but not seen.

The Monroe Police Department will continue to investigate the incident.

The teller gave the man an unspecified amount of cash, and he fled the area on foot.

Police described the robber as a white man, mid -40s, wearing a brown coat, camouflage hat and work boots. He has dark brown hair and a full dark-brown beard interspersed with gray.

Anyone with information about the robbery is urged to call the Monroe Police Department at 360-794-6300 or the anonymous tip line at 360-863-4600.
